Analyse des Politiques de Trump et la Crise Actuelle du Fentanyl: Un Lien de Cause à Effet ?

The United States is grappling with an unprecedented fentanyl crisis, claiming tens of thousands of lives annually. While the opioid epidemic has been a long-standing issue, the surge in fentanyl-related deaths in recent years has prompted intense scrutiny of past policies and their potential contribution to the current catastrophe. This article analyzes the Trump administration's policies on drug control and explores their potential link to the escalating fentanyl crisis. We examine the successes and failures of these policies, considering expert opinions and statistical data to paint a comprehensive picture.

Trump's Approach to the Opioid Crisis: A Focus on Border Security

The Trump administration framed the opioid crisis largely through the lens of border security, emphasizing the flow of illicit drugs across the US-Mexico border. Key policies included:

  • Increased border enforcement: The administration invested heavily in border wall construction and increased the number of border patrol agents. The goal was to stem the flow of all illicit drugs, including fentanyl.
  • Pressure on Mexico: The Trump administration frequently pressured the Mexican government to do more to combat drug trafficking within its territory. This involved both diplomatic pressure and the threat of tariffs.
  • Targeting Chinese chemical suppliers: Recognizing China as a major source of precursor chemicals used in fentanyl production, the administration imposed sanctions on some Chinese companies.

Did these policies succeed in curbing the fentanyl crisis?

While increased border security might have had some impact on the overall flow of drugs, evidence suggests it did little to significantly curb the fentanyl crisis. The highly potent nature of fentanyl means that even small quantities can cause widespread devastation. Furthermore, fentanyl is increasingly synthesized domestically, making border control less effective.

  • The limitations of border control: The decentralized and clandestine nature of fentanyl trafficking renders traditional border security measures less effective than initially hoped.
  • The rise of domestic production: Fentanyl is increasingly produced within the United States, often using precursor chemicals sourced both domestically and internationally.
  • Data limitations: Accurate data on fentanyl trafficking routes and the effectiveness of border control measures remains a challenge.

Beyond Border Security: The Need for a Multifaceted Approach

Critics argue that the Trump administration’s focus on border security overshadowed other crucial aspects of addressing the opioid crisis. A truly effective strategy requires a multifaceted approach encompassing:

  • Treatment and prevention: Expanding access to addiction treatment, harm reduction strategies (like naloxone distribution), and public health campaigns aimed at prevention are crucial.
  • International cooperation: Stronger collaborations with countries like China and Mexico are essential to disrupt the supply chain at its source. This requires diplomacy and intelligence sharing, beyond simple pressure tactics.
  • Regulation and enforcement: Increased enforcement against domestic fentanyl production and trafficking networks is necessary, alongside stricter regulations on precursor chemicals.

The Missing Pieces: Treatment and Prevention

The lack of substantial investment in treatment and prevention programs under the Trump administration is a major point of contention. While increased border security might prevent some fentanyl from entering the country, it does little to address the underlying issues of addiction and access to care.

Conclusion: A Complex Issue Demands a Holistic Solution

The current fentanyl crisis is a complex public health emergency demanding a holistic and comprehensive response. While the Trump administration’s policies focused heavily on border security, their effectiveness in mitigating the fentanyl crisis remains debatable. Future strategies must embrace a multifaceted approach, encompassing border control, international cooperation, and significantly increased investment in treatment, prevention, and harm reduction programs. Ignoring any of these elements will likely result in continued devastating losses.
